I have a similar TT and normal brake drum temps with a IR digital reader shows 100 to 150 depending on how much braking action I have to use (stop & go) or decelerating from interstate into rest area. What's important to me is uniform temperatures at each drum, within 10 degrees or so, …
WebI have been using raytech gun on rotors and drums for over ten years. Normally after a one to two mile trip I see rear drums around 120-160. Rear rotors usually go about 150-220. Fronts are usually hotter at 200-250. In cases of noise concerns after more like ten miles of hard braking 350-400 in front is still normal.

The near side remain cool. The workshop has looked … biomat donor technicianWeb20 jun. 2009 · Mine tend to travel at around 115-120 F. I think much over 160-170 would be too hot for me. Coming down Pikes Peak in Colorado there is a brake check station and if you are over 300 degrees you must stop and let them cool. If you can feel heat radiating from the brakes I would get them checked. Something is not right. biomat cushion
